Human Capital

ATTRACT
  • High company growth and increased excitement about the company
  • High position standards/requirements (increasing each month)
  • However, they look further than knowledge, ability, and skill and focus on personality, attitudes, values, beliefs, and interests.
    • Example application questions:
      • You know that book (and website) about 6 word memoirs?  Well, now is your chance to write one.  We want to hear your six word memoir.
      • Tell us what you do for fun.  This can be having a drink with your friends or playing chess --we don't care what you do, we just want to know what you do outside the office.
      • Working at Tough Mudder is more than a job and is even more than a career -- it's a lifestyle.  Tell us why you want your work to become a lifestyle and the benefit of achieving such a thing.
  • Everyone starts with an internship.  This gives Tough Mudder a trial period to see if new hires fit in -- they have time to decide whether to make a permanent offer.
  • Have a fun and attractive corporate culture.  From their website:

DEVELOP
  • Tough Mudder University
    • Harvard Business Review case studies
    • Mock HBS classes
    • Reading program
  • Employees are not limited to their position responsibilities.
    • "At Tough Mudder, you'll learn everything from how to construct a quarter pipe to the in-and-outs of business development, brand management, and event production."
  • Tough Mudder Ventures
    • Start-up funding initiative that provides seed financing, office space, mentorship, and more to former Tough Mudder employees who launch their own businesses.
    • They believe that people are their greatest competitive advantage and want to enable them to bring their visions to reality.
RETAIN
  • Tough Mudder believes that hard work deserves to be rewarded.  Employee benefits:
    • Up to five weeks of vacation per year plus official holidays
    • Competitive health insurance benefits
    • Free food and drink in the office
    • Free gym membership "as long as you use it!"
    • 40% off Under Armour gear
    • iPad for finishing internship
    • Attend regular company retreats in the Catskills
    • Profit sharing plan
  • Employees are helping to build an exciting endurance sports brand.  Belief and passion about mission.
